Australian Firm Focusing Exclusively on Manufactured Housing Communities

Updating a story we last posted Sept. 4, 2013 about the acquisition of two manufactured housing community (MHCs) properties by Ingenia Communities in Australia, MHProNews has learned the company has raised $61.5 million to fund the acquisition of eight additional MHCs. Although contracts have been exchanged on only the Drifters Holiday Village at Kingscliff on the north coast of New South Wales (NSW), the company will announce the purchase of the remaining seven properties when the deals are finalized. Chief Executive Simon Owen states the company intends to focus solely on MHCs. “We spent two years researching this market before we made our first acquisition,” he said. All eight properties are in NSW, close to urban areas, or in Sydney. “We want to build a dominant footprint in the NSW market before we look to expanding into Queensland and Western Australia,” Mr. Owen said, as reported by theaustralian.com.au.
